Getting Around the Englewood Park Neighborhood in Orlando, FL

Walk Score®

63 / 100

Somewhat Walkable

Some errands can be accomplished on foot

Bike Score®

58 / 100

Bikeable

Some bike infrastructure

Transit Score®

27 / 100

Some Transit

A few nearby public transportation options

Frequently Asked Questions about Short-term Englewood Park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Short-term Englewood Park Apartment?

The average rent for a Short-term Apartment in Englewood Park is $1,991.

What is the largest Short-term Englewood Park Apartment for rent?

Today's Short-term apartment with the most square footage in Englewood Park is a 1,295 square feet unit starting from $1,280 at Cadence Crossing.

What is the average size for Englewood Park Short-term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Short-term rental in Englewood Park is currently at 603 sq ft.
